[…] alone without his faithful Antigone to die a peaceful death. La Fura dels Baus presented last year a powerful production of Ligeti´s revulsive "Le grand macabre". Now they gave us a dramatically intense "Oedipe" though with some absurd extravagances, such as the Sphinx represented by a Nazi Stuka plane, and generally deplorable costumes. But some aspects were stunning, apart from their very good theatrical handling of the singer-actors. The First Act was admirable: a four-tiered mud-colored wall contained the singers and a myriad of terracotta statues, representing the Palace of Thebes. The Second Act has three contrasting tableaux, at the court of Corinth, at a crossroads (where provoked Oedipus kills his father Laios inadvertently) […]
